Shigenao Kawai is a scholar working on Plant Science, Pollution and Environmental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Shigenao Kawai has authored 59 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 45 papers in Plant Science, 13 papers in Pollution and 11 papers in Environmental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Shigenao Kawai’s work include Plant Micronutrient Interactions and Effects (31 papers),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(28 papers) and Aluminum toxicity and tolerance in plants and animals (14 papers). Shigenao Kawai is often cited by papers focused on Plant Micronutrient Interactions and Effects (31 papers),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(28 papers) and Aluminum toxicity and tolerance in plants and animals (14 papers). Shigenao Kawai collaborates with scholars based in Japan, Bangladesh and Norway. Shigenao Kawai's co-authors include Shah Alam, Molla Rahman Shaibur, Shigeru Kamei, Md. Abul Kashem, Seiichi Takagi, S. M. Imamul Huq, Nobuyuki Kitajima, Bal Ram Singh, Kyosuke Nomoto and Kikukatsu Ito and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Chromatography A, Plant and Soil and Tetrahedron Letters.
